In this performance comparison, the vivo V60e with its MediaTek Dimensity 7360 (4nm) performs better than the Oppo F31 with the Mediatek Dimensity 6300 (4nm), thanks to superior chipset efficiency.
vivo V60e offers 3 years of OS updates, whereas Oppo F31 provides 2 years. For security updates, vivo V60e offers 5 years of support compared to Oppo F31's 3 years.
Both Oppo F31 and vivo V60e feature AMOLED displays, offering vibrant colors and deeper blacks. Both smartphones offer the same 120 Hz refresh rate. vivo V60e also boasts a brighter screen with 5000 nits of peak brightness, enhancing outdoor visibility. Both phones have the same screen resolution.
Oppo F31 comes with a larger 7000 mAh battery, which may offer longer usage on a single charge. vivo V60e also supports faster wired charging at 90W, compared to 80W on Oppo F31.
Both phones feature the same IP69 rating for water and dust resistance.
